SSE / GO
Role
- Take ownership of the backend tasks and work closely with the development teams
- Strategic choice of data structure and algorithms to design and implement the business logic
- Develop, test, document, and deploy web APIs, batch jobs, webhooks, or integrations based on the business requirements
- Heavy emphasis on code testing and designing for testability
- Continuously document design decisions
- Adopt best DevOps/tech-ops practices and make continuous automated testing, releases, and deployments
- Offer mentorship to junior developers in the team
Qualifications & Experience
- Bachelor of Science in Computer Science or equivalent practical experiences
- Possess strong programming skills, solid data structure, and algorithm fundamentals
- Possess strong system design and architecting skills with distributed systems
- At least 2 years of experience with AWS/GCP services and related cloud technologies
- At least 4 years of practical backend development for real-world products in any language/framework, preferably in Go
- Experience in SQL databases, writing schemas, and designing high performance queries
- Experience in in-memory key-value databases like Redis
- Deep technical understanding of scalability, resilience, high availability, and the corresponding architecture, technologies, and designs
- Experiences with DevOps/tech ops, like Jenkins, GitLab, CI/CD, Ansible, and Terraform
- Experience in Containerization and Orchestration technologies like Docker and Kubernetes
- Strong troubleshooting and debugging skills
- Self-motivated and willing to learn new technologies continuously
- Embrace the open-source community
Company: Maritime International Limited
Company email: [email protected]
Job Location: Colombp
Job Category: Software Development / Web / QA / Data / GIS
Job Type: Full Time
